What you will study
This program consists of a pathway program offered by StudyGroup at the International Study Centre at Liverpool John Moores University followed by entry into a university program offered at Liverpool John Moores University. In your international foundation year, you will study courses related to your intended field of study alongside English to develop and enhance your skills as a student. Advancement into your intended program depends upon the successful completion of the pathway program.
The International Foundation Year in Engineering, Computing and Life Sciences will familiarize you with a wide area of study. You will develop your critical thinking skills, creativity, analytical and team working skills, providing you with the most crucial skills required as a successful graduate.
The BSc (Hons) Cyber Security at Liverpool John Moores University is informed by internationally important research, which means your studies will be at the forefront of developments in this important field. The course is accredited by the British Computer Society (BCS).
As we increase the scope of our working and personal lives online there has been a rise in the number of attacks being made against information systems by hackers and other criminals looking to steal resources. It seems that on a weekly basis there is another news story detailing a new ransomware attack or a new vulnerability in a piece of software used by the public.
The UK government has identified a skills gap and therefore a need for more staff trained in Computer Security. Students graduating from the Computer Security course will be in demand by companies looking to fill their Computer Security roles with trained staff. LJMU has a growing national and international reputation for its research into computer security and this expertise ensures the degree is at the leading edge of developments in this discipline.
